We are Looking for Section Managers – Zara (Full Time) In Derby For Menswear and Kidswear
Reporting to: General Manager / Deputy Store Manager


About the Role


As a Section Manager at Zara, you support senior management in leading a section of the store, driving commercial performance, and creating an inclusive, engaging, and fast-paced environment. You will coordinate daily shop floor activity, support and motivate the team, and ensure company standards are met while delivering a strong, customer-focused experience.


This role is suited to individuals who bring the right mindset people who are adaptable, empathetic, reliable, and resilient, and who can manage time effectively while working confidently under pressure. You enjoy working with product, data, and people, value collaboration, and take pride in contributing to shared success. We welcome applicants from all backgrounds and experiences.


Key Responsibilities


Commercial & Product



  • Deliver floor layout and merchandising in line with company guidelines and commercial priorities.


  • Promote new collections and key products, adapting layouts using commercial reports, sales data, and customer insights.


  • Monitor product availability across all categories, responding proactively to trends and customer demand.


  • Maintain store image, cleanliness, and organisation to create an accessible, welcoming, and customer-focused environment.



Operations & Stock



  • Ensure effective replenishment, delivery management, and stockroom organisation in a fast-paced setting.


  • Support omnichannel , managing daily deadlines with strong time management and attention to detail.


  • Use and support in-store technology and operational systems to maintain efficiency and accuracy.



People & Inclusive Culture



  • Lead by example with an empathetic and values-led approach, fostering a respectful, inclusive, and collaborative team culture.


  • Support productivity through clear planning, fair delegation, and effective communication, especially during peak trading periods.


  • Apply HR policies, absence processes, and the Code of Conduct consistently, fairly, and with professionalism.


  • Encourage well being conversations, engagement, accountability, and shared responsibility within the team.



Learning & Development



  • Support performance reviews, development plans, and internal progression.


  • Coach and mentor team members, recognising different strengths, experiences, and learning styles.


  • Promote continuous learning, confidence, and resilience across the team.



Customer Experience



  • Ensure a consistently high standard of customer service across your section.


  • Support the team with strong product knowledge, styling guidance, and awareness of new arrivals and best sellers.


  • Resolve customer queries with empathy, professionalism, and a solution-focused mindset.



Health, Safety & Sustainability



  • Promote a safe, tidy, and inclusive environment for customers and colleagues.


  • Follow health and safety procedures and actively support sustainable and responsible ways of working.



Experience



  • Experience in a fast-paced retail environment.


  • Experience supporting or leading a team.


  • Confidence working with sales data, stock, and operational processes.



Skills & Attributes



  • Empathetic, inclusive leadership style with strong communication skills.


  • Strong time management and organisational abilities, with the resilience to work under pressure.


  • Adaptable, reliable, and proactive approach to problem-solving and decision-making.


  • Customer-focused with a values-driven mindset.


  • Comfortable working independently and collaboratively.


  • Good numeracy skills and attention to detail.


  • Motivation to learn, develop, and support others.
